What is a Lockout Control Board?

Lockout control boards are visual management tools designed to clearly display lockout/tagout procedures, ensuring that all safety protocols are easily accessible and understood. These boards typically include sections for documenting which machinery is locked out, the date of lockdown, and the personnel involved. This centralized information helps eliminate confusion and keeps safety at the forefront.

Importance in Workplace Safety

Implementing a lockout control board significantly reduces the risk of accidental machine startups during maintenance. By following the established procedures displayed on the board, organizations can cultivate a safer work environment. Moreover, having a visible reference promotes accountability among employees, as everyone is aware of their responsibilities.

Enhancing Compliance and Training

A well-organized lockout control board also plays a crucial role in training new employees. It serves as a quick reference guide, easing the onboarding process and ensuring that all team members understand the importance of LOTO procedures. Furthermore, regular updates to the board can help maintain compliance with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) regulations, thereby minimizing potential fines and enhancing workplace culture.
